I think I need a Boost

I was referred to this forum by the great RX-7 Carl. Here is the problem I have a 79 RX-7, about 20 years ago I installed a BAE Turbo Charger kit. The car ran like a bat out of hell that turbo would kick in and whoosh like a sling shot.
Through the years a slight stalling problem evolved into a constant stalling problem. Over the years it also started to smoke. So I took off turbo tied to clean it started smoking like a chimney sent it out and had it rebuilt the turbo is a ray-jay. Turbo comes back put it on, no more smoke but boost gauge did not show boost.
Now to present time I discovered vacuum leaks fixed them. I start car I look at my boost gauge it use to read 0 now it reads 11 lbs vacuum I wind it out it feels like it goes in to boost but I am not sure. Boost gauge goes from 11 lbs to 0 but does not show boost to the right side of gauge.
I contact were turbo was repaired they say if you give it a spin it should make at least one revolution it does but I remember the old turbo spinning like a fan when you would give a spin the repaired one a revaluation and half or two.
Next I disassemble the waste gate all looks fine it has a plate a spring and piston attached to a rubber gasket ho holes in gasket how do I check if the waste gate is operating correctly? If it were not would it blow the entire boost out the waste gate? I hope the team of the rotary performance forum can help.

Make sure all of the turbo outlet piping is tight. You can apply pressure to the waste gate actuator to verify that it opens. Mity vac turbo systems test pumps are handy for this kind of stuff.

Oh, & the wastegate doesn't vent boost, it routes exhaust gasses & pressure around the turbo reducing the turbo RPM & compressor pressure/flow.

I have one of those mighty vacs and when you pump it shows nothing, so I rig up some fittings so it fits my air compressor soon as you start to let air in you hear the wastegate hissing I give more pressure the valve retracts whoosh out the pressure vents. So from what I have been researching my understanding is if the wastegate was not operating correctly it would stay closed and I should show boost and possibly overboost and blow up the engine or the turbo but the gauge goes from 12lbs vacuum to 0 but never shows boost. I did test the boost gauge with the mighty vac it shows vacuum and pressure and holds both. Years ago the gauge did show boost.
